The journey to a stunning vertical garden begins with understanding the types of features you might consider. Vertical gardens, arbors, trellises, and pergolas are all excellent choices for adding dimension and interest to your landscape. Unlike traditional gardens that focus on horizontal layouts, vertical elements make use of the skyward space, ideal for smaller yards or areas where ground space is limited.
Vertical gardens, for instance, are perfect for bringing color and texture to barren fences or patio walls. They provide a lush appearance by allowing a variety of plants to cascade or climb, creating a curtain of greenery. The choice of plants is crucial; consider species like ivy, ferns, or flowering climbers such as clematis and morning glories. These plants not only enhance visual appeal but also require minimal ground space, making them a practical option.
Incorporating structures like arbors and pergolas adds architectural interest and functional utility. Arbors create inviting entryways or focal points, favoring climbing roses or grapevines that can envelop the structure over time. Pergolas are ideal for larger spaces, offering both shade and a framework for additional plantings. Whether used to define an outdoor dining area or a cozy reading nook, pergolas serve dual purposes of style and function.
Trellises, on the other hand, are a versatile choice that can be used both independently and as support for other structures. They lead the eyes upward, contributing to the illusion of a larger space. Utilize trellises for growing vining vegetables or ornamental plants, which can embody vertical gardens effectively. This not only maximizes planting options but also adds a new dimension to garden design.
Choosing the right materials and placements is essential when designing with vertical elements. Wood, metal, or even recycled materials can be used, each offering a unique aesthetic. Wood provides a natural look that integrates seamlessly with plant life, whereas metal imparts a modern edge, suitable for sleek, contemporary gardens. Placement is crucial; situate elements in spots that receive ample sunlight, allowing plants to thrive and ensuring the structures serve their intended purpose effectively.
